Murree vs Tontouta Climate & Distance Between

New Caledonia flag
  • The distance between Murree, Pakistan and Tontouta, New Caledonia is approximately 11,600 km or 7,208 mi.
  • To reach Murree in this distance one would set out from Tontouta bearing 301.2°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Murree bearing 287.1° or WNW .
  • Murree has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b) whereas Tontouta has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• The annual average temperature is 9.9 °C (17.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.8 °C (17.6°F) more in Murree.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 836.3 mm (32.9 in) more which is equivalent to 836.3 l/m² (20.52 US gal/ft²) or 8,363,000 l/ha (894,060 US gal/ac) more. About 1 7/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.7° lower in Murree than in Tontouta.
